Output 18fc8af202a91cc7aed5c85a550ad2076a7cad2a55f873c76d13d595eecebd1a:34

value
317298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c62813ab387cd63e6c41b6f962d3a4497a40f9a OP_EQUAL
address
3LKhmun99q1B9AwQSMHgwZrHdE1LBhvTe7
transaction
18fc8af202a91cc7aed5c85a550ad2076a7cad2a55f873c76d13d595eecebd1a
spent
true